Hernando César Molina Araújo (born August 28, 1961 in Valledupar) is a Colombian politician.
Son of Hernando Molina Céspedes and Consuelo Araújo, he studied at the Colegio Nacional Loperena in Valledupar and later studied Law in the Antonio Nariño University, but dropped out.
He declares himself a self-taught man.
Molina was governor of the Colombian Department of Cesar for the period 2004–2007, a term which he did not complete due to his involvement in the Parapolitica scandal.
he was called to testify on May 17, 2007 at the Office of the Attorney General of Colombia.
